so you'd rather do away with AD's and have individual coaches deal with bus scheduling, referee scheduling, concessions, gate money, tickets, security, cleanup, paperwork, banquets, parking, game contracts, fundraiser organization, booster club contact, programs, finances, athletic account bookkeeping, budgets, etc, etc , etc

 

a good AD is a coaches dream to take away all the above nightmares that DETRACT from the actual coaching time a coach puts in

 

in 90% of all the hirings and firings the AD isn't the SOLE decision maker
